What Makes Tirzepatide Structurally Distinct
Unlike Semaglutide, which extends GLP-1 receptor engagement, Tirzepatide is engineered to activate both the GLP-1 receptor and the GIP (glucose-dependent insulinotropic polypeptide) receptor within a single sequence. That dual-agonist design is the entire reason researchers request it specifically — it enables combined-pathway signaling studies that a single-receptor compound simply can't replicate, regardless of dosage or duration.

Common Tirzepatide Sourcing Red Flags
Because Tirzepatide is larger and more expensive to synthesize correctly than single-receptor GLP-1 analogs, unusually low pricing relative to market average is a particularly strong warning sign — it's one of the more difficult peptides to manufacture correctly, and cut-rate pricing often reflects cut corners on synthesis quality or verification rather than genuine efficiency. Other red flags carry over from the broader research peptide market: reluctance to provide a lot-specific COA, marketing language that strays into human dosing territory, and HPLC purity claims without accompanying mass-spec sequence data.
Tirzepatide Storage & Handling for Researchers
Store lyophilized Tirzepatide at -20°C until ready for use. Given its larger, more complex structure, extra care during reconstitution and handling is worthwhile — aliquot into single-use volumes immediately after reconstitution, minimize freeze-thaw cycling, and follow your lab's established buffer protocol for peptide stability rather than assuming a generic approach will preserve structural integrity across a multi-week study.
